Recipe
Patterned papers - My Mind's Eye Bloom & Grow stack
Cardstock - Recollections
Tree, 'little' - Simply Charmed
'pumpkins' - Plantin Schoolbook, welded with my Gypsy
Martha Stewart pumpkin border punch
Cuttlebug d'vine swirls on tree
Cuttlebug distressed stripes on tree trunk
Orange peel Stickles on leaves
Cat's Eye chalk ink in chestnut roan
White Gelly Roll pen; black and brown Creative Memories markers for doodling & journaling
Button from stash to mimic hole in tree
Pop dots
